Brains
I’m not sure if this really belongs in a time-sink category, but for whatever reason I took the challenge to see if my brain was feminine or masculine. The result? Well…
Okay, let’s walk through the results.
1. The Angle Test: 13 out of 20.
Comment: I’ve always had a problem with tasks related to geometry and shapes. Tell me to turn left, and I will actually have to think for some seconds about the direction. I also regularly walk into door-frames and furniture.
2. Spot the difference (Objects moving place): 21%
Comment: The good news is that this means that my short-time memory isn’t zapped.
3. Thumbs up: Left
Comment: FWIW, I’m extremely left-handed. The result doesn’t fit with #1 and #8
4. Empathising and systematising: Your empathy score is: 7 out of 20; Your systematising score is: 11 out of 20.
Comment: Hmmm… A professional researcher ought to do better in the systematising business.
5. Ability to judge people’s emotions: 7 out of 10.
Comment: This doesn’t fit with with #4 although there might be such a thing as defensive empathy. If you know what I mean.
6. Fingers: Right Hand: 1.06, Left Hand: 1.02.
Comment: I must have some spooky hands. I never noticed that my left and right hands were so different.
7. Faces: Your choices suggest you prefer more feminine faces.
Comment: I’m, like, totally surprised. But this one is fairly easy to bust.
8. 3D shapes: Your score: 7 out of 12.
Comment: See under #1.
9. Word association: You associated 7 word(s) with grey and you named 8 word(s) that mean happy. [Total: 15] We are assuming that all the words you entered are correct.
Comment: Biology or work-related injury? I’ve basically spent my life since I was 6 in very verbal environments and I’ve always been a very good writer.
10. Ultimatum: If you had to split £50 with someone, you said you would demand £25.
Comment: Obviously, there is a reason why I never entered politics. I’m not quite convinced by the description of the results of previous tests and “typically” male and female behaviours. But maybe I should have my testosterone level checked at some point just for the fun of it.
